식도암 환자에서의 Half Beam 치료법의 유용성 평가 (The Usability Evaluation Half Beam Radiation Treatment Technique on the Esophageal Cancer)

  • 식도암은 병변의 길이가 길고 깊이의 불균질성으로 인하여 방사선의 균일한 선량분포를 얻기 어렵다. 이러한 문제점을 개선해 보고자 Half beam 법을 이용하여 선량분포의 균질성을 극복해 보고자 환자의 영상을 바탕으로 하여 Normal beam과 Half beam을 이용하여 각각 치료계획을 세워 표적체적포함율과 선량체적곡선, 일치성지수와 균질성지수를 상호 비교하고, 인접정상장기인 심장, 척수, 폐를 비교해 보고자 한다. 실험결과 Half beam을 이용한 치료계획이 표적체적포함율과 선량체적곡선 그리고 일치성지수와 균질성지수가 우수하였으며 정상조직 보호측면에서도 미미하지만 우수한 것으로 나타났다. 하지만 정확한 환자자세가 확보되지 않으면 부작용이 발생할 수 있다. 따라서, 기하학적으로 정확한 환자의 위치잡이를 수반한 Half beam의 적용은 선량적으로 유용할 수 있을 것으로 사료된다.

  • Contact interaction of a beam (flexible element) with an elastic half-plane is considered, when a soft inhomogeneous (functionally graded) interlayer is present between them. The beam is bent under the action of a distributed load applied to the surface and a reaction of the elastic interlayer and the half-space. Solution of the contact problem is obtained for different values of thickness and parameters of inhomogeneity of the layer. The interlayer is assumed to be significantly softer than the underlying half-plane; case of 100 times difference in Young's moduli is considered as an example. The influence of the interlayer thickness and gradient of elastic properties on the distribution of the contact stresses under the beam is studied.

Reference X-ray Irradiation System for Personal Dosimeter Testing and Calibration of Radiation Detector

  • Background: In the calibration and testing laboratory of Korea Atomic Energy Research Institute, the old X-ray generator used for the production of reference X-ray fields was replaced with a new one. For this newly installed X-ray irradiation system, beam alignment as well as the verification of beam qualities was conducted. Materials and Methods: The existing X-ray generator, Phillips MG325, was replaced with YXLON Y.TU 320-D03 in order to generate reference X-ray fields. Theoretical calculations and Monte Carlo simulations were used to determine initial filter thickness. Beam alignment was performed in three steps to deliver a homogeneous radiation dosage to the target at different distances. Finally, the half-value layers were measured for different X-ray fields to verify beam qualities by using an ion chamber. Results and Discussion: Beam alignment was performed in three steps, and collimators and other components were arranged to maintain the uniformity of the mean air kerma rate within ${\pm}2.5%$ at the effective beam diameter of 28 cm. The beam quality was verified by using half-value layer measurement methods specified by American National Standard Institute (ANSI) N13.11-2009 and International Organization for Standardization (ISO)-4037. For each of the nine beams than can be generated by the new X-ray irradiation system, air kerma rates for X-ray fields of different beam qualifies were measured. The results showed that each air kerma rate and homogeneity coefficient of the first and second half-value layers were within ${\pm}5%$ of the recommended values in the standard documents. Conclusion: The results showed that the new X-ray irradiation system provides beam qualities that are as high as moderate beam qualities offered by National Institute of Standards and Technology in ANSI N13.11-2009 and those for narrow-spectrum series of ISO-4037.

  • The vibration analysis of damped sandwich beam is conducted using finite element method. The equation of motion presented by Mead and Markus is used to formulate FEM. Also as the thickness of the core in the damped sandwich beam goes to zero, conventional beam theory based on the transformed-section method and the equation of Mead and Markus are compared. According to the change of thickness and loss factor of the core, the forced frequency response of beam is calculated and discussed. And then using the half-power band width method, the damping ratio of each mode is calculated and discussed about each case.

  • This paper is to study the mechanical behavor and structural safety of the wire-mesh half slab by an analytical method. Layer model was adopted by modelling the wire-mesh half slab as a flexural member composed of free cantilever beam and vertical supports (walls or beams). Reasonable results for the prediction of ultimate strength of the half stab at each loading direction and design recommendations for the reinforcement detail at wall(beam)-slab joints are acquired. On the other hand, ductility capacity of the wire-mesh half slab was overestimated by not considering the brittleness of wire-mesh reinforcements pre-manufactured at the form of Kaiser Truss.

  • In this paper, by using the Rayleigh-Sommer field theory and the cross-spectral density function, the analytical expression for the intensity distribution of a double half-Gaussian hollow beam in a turbulent atmosphere is obtained. The influence of the initial spot size of this beam on its propagation properties in a turbulent atmosphere is simulated, and the intensity distributions for such beams with different spot sizes are obtained. The results show that the initial spot size has an important influence on the propagation properties in the near field, while this influence in the far field is very weak.

  • 두경부 종양의 방사선치료에서 비대칭 콜리메이터를 이용한 이분조사는 두 조사면을 겹침없이 연결시켜 조사할 수 있는 효과적인 방법이고, 동일 방사선 조사면을 분리하여 X-선과 전자선을 인접시켜 조사하는 경우는 빈번히 사용되는 방법이다. 본 연구는 X-선의 이분조사면을 이용한 두 조사면의 인접면의 선량과, X-선과 전자선 조사면의 인접면에서 선량을 측정하여 임상에 적용할 수 있는 자료를 얻고자 하였다. X-선의 반쪽 조사면의 선량측정에서 하부 전방 단일 이분조사면의 선량분포는 Y축이 0 cm인 면(콜리메이터가 닫힌 면)에서 0.5 cm, 1 cm 거리에서는 각각 개방조사 선량의 93%, 95%, 전후방 이분조사의 경우 Y축이 0 cm인 면에서 0.3 cm, 0.5 cm, 1 cm거리에서는 각각 개방조사 선량의 92%, 95%, 98%로 선량감소를 보였다. X-선과 전자선의 조사면을 인접시켰을 때 깊이 0 cm, 0.5 cm, 1.5 cm, 2 cm, 3 cm에서의 두 조사면의 인접면에서의 선량 분포의 분석에서 X-선 조사면에서 선량 증가는 깊이 1.5 cm에서 폭 7 mm에 걸쳐 있었고 최고 6%의 증가를 보였으며 다른 측정 깊이에서는 선량증가가 허용범위 내에 있었다. 그리고 전자선 조사면쪽에서 선랑 감소는 전 측정 깊이 0.5 cm-3 cm에서 각각 폭이 1mm-12.5 mm에 걸쳐 4.5%- 30%의 주변부 보다 선량감소를 보였다. 본 연구에서 이분 조사면의 선량은 콜리메이터가 닫힌 면에서 감소함을 확인하였다. 그리고 X-선과 전자선을 인접시켜 조사 할 때 두 조사면의 인접면을 중심으로 X-선 조사면 쪽에서 선량증가, 전자선 조사면쪽에서 선량 감소를 보임을 확인하였다.

  • In a split beam echo sounder, the transducer design needs to have minimal side lobes because the angular position and level of the side lobes establishes the usable signal level and phase angle limits for determining target strength. In order to suppress effectively the generation of unwanted side lobes in the directivity pattern of split beam transducer, the spacing and size of the transducer elements need to be controlled less than half of a wavelength. With this purpose, a 50 kHz tonpilz type transducer with a half-wavelength diameter in relation to the development of a split beam transducer was designed using the equivalent circuit model, and the underwater performance characteristics were measured and analyzed. From the in-air and in-water impedance responses, the measured value of the electro-acoustic conversion efficiency for the designed transducer was 51.6%. A maximum transmitting voltage response (TVR) value of 172.25dB re $1{\mu}Pa/V$ at 1m was achieved at 52.92kHz with a specially designed matching network and the quality factor was 10.3 with the transmitting bandwidth of 5.14kHz. A maximum receiving sensitivity (SRT) of -183.57dB re $1V/{\mu}Pa$ was measured at 51.45kHz and the receiving bandwidth at -3dB was 1.71kHz. These results suggest that the designed tonpilz type transducer can be effectively used in the development of a split beam transducer for a 50kHz fish sizing echo sounder.

  • This paper concerned with the vibration of double walled carbon nanotubes (CNTs) as continuum model based on Timoshenko-beam theory. The vibration solution obtained from Timoshenko-beam theory provides a better presentation of vibration structure of carbon nanotubes. The natural frequencies of double-walled CNTs against half axial wave mode are investigated. The frequency decreases on decreasing the half axial wave mode. The shape of frequency arcs is different for various lengths. It is observed that model has produced lowest results for C-F and highest for C-C. A large parametric study is performed to see the effect of half axial wave mode on frequencies of CNTs. This numerically vibration solution delivers a benchmark results for other techniques. The comparison of present model is exhibited with previous studies and good agreement is found.

  • Ring beam is the main anchorage zone of the tendons in the nuclear power prestressed concrete containment vessel (PCCV). Its safety is crucial and has a great influence on the overall performance of PCCV. In this paper, two half-scale ring beams were tested to investigate the mechanical performance of the anchorage zone in the PCCV under multidirectional pressure. The effect of working condition with different tension sequences was investigated. Additionally, a half axisymmetric plane model of the containment was established by the finite element simulation to further predict the experimental responses and propose the local reinforcement design in the anchorage zone of the ring beam. The results showed that the ultimate load of the specimens under both working conditions was greater than the nominal ultimate tensile force. The original reinforcement design could meet the bearing capacity requirements, but there was still room for optimization. The ring beam was generally under pressure in the anchorage area, while the splitting force appeared in the under-anchor area, and the spalling force appeared in the corner area of the tooth block, which could be targeted for local strengthening design.
